Tungxen Industrial Park in Kinta, Perak recorded 4 subsale transactions between 2021 and 2026, with a median price of RM 2.25 million and a median price per square foot (PSF) of RM 50.

Price remained flat, and PSF growth was PSF remained flat. The median price is RM 2.25 million, with most transactions falling within a stable range of RM 2.15 million to RM 2.35 million, and a typical market range of RM 2.17 million to RM 2.33 million.

Most transactions involved detached factory/warehouse, with minimal variety in property types.

For price per square foot, the median is RM 50, with most transactions between RM 48 and RM 52. The usual range is RM 48.09 to RM 52.09, showing that most units are priced quite close to each other. A typical spread (IQR) of RM 4.00 and an average deviation (MAD) of RM 2 indicate a highly stable PSF trend across properties.
